Hi, and welcome aboard. I'm handing over release duties for LiftSim, our elevator-dispatch simulator. Weekly builds go out Thursdays; always run the full dispatch-scenario suite first and note any regressions in the Harrowgate tracker. Each release tarball must be signed before upload to the distribution share. The signing key you'll need is included just below.

release key, kawif-hawep: bky13_X7TGuRG4Zu4ZJ

Subject: KioskWatch cut-over complete

Hi Marit,

The cut-over of the KioskWatch watchdog for the BrellaPoint kiosk fleet finished at 02:40 last night. All 112 kiosks in the Daxholm pilot region restarted cleanly, and the watchdog now reports heartbeats through the new Pulsegate channel. We retired the legacy cron-based restarter and confirmed no orphaned processes remain. Rollback scripts stay staged for one more week per policy. For the record, these are the watchdog's configuration values as deployed.

service settings:
quenath:
  log_level: info
  metrics_host: metrics.quenath.tolvaqlabs.internal
  pin: 1407
  pool_size: 8

Quick handover before I'm off! Over the Midwinter break, Aldercroft House runs reduced hours: doors open 09:00–15:00 from the 23rd to the 2nd. New starters should know the main entrance is card-only during this window and reception is unstaffed after noon. If the card reader doesn't recognise you yet, there's a temporary keypad entry, and the holiday code is below.

door code, yagap-bahof: bdg-O-05

**Vendor note: Inkmill markdown pipeline**

Rendering for Parchway docs is outsourced to Inkmill under an annual contract, renewing each March. They handle sanitization and PDF export; we own the upload queue. SLA: 4-hour response on rendering failures. Escalate only after two failed retries. Their support desk is reachable at the address below.

billing contact of hahaf-baguf = zorael.tammir.jorius@sivrelhq.internal